Understanding ISO 20022: A Modern Financial Language

ISO 20022 is essentially a standardised, XML-based language for financial transactions. Imagine upgrading from an old, clunky telegram system to high-speed, data-rich email—that's the essence of the change. It allows for richer, more detailed data contained within each message, greatly improving efficiency and transparency in cross-border payments and other financial interactions. This means more data, and clearer data, leading to fewer errors and a smoother workflow. The shift to this new standard is not optional; it's a necessary evolution for participation in the global financial arena.
